Varanasi Play School Teacher Booked After Child Alleges Abuse

Varanasi: A teacher at a private play school in Varanasi has been accused of physically abusing a five-year-old student after he accidentally urinated in his pants. Police have registered an FIR based on a complaint filed by the child's father and have launched an investigation.
According to the complaint, the incident took place on July 24 at Serene Sony Play School. The child, whose father is an advocate, had reportedly asked his class teacher for permission to use the washroom. The family alleges that the teacher refused, causing the child to lose control and urinate in his clothes.
The parents further alleged that the teacher then took the child to another room, heated a knife, and burned his private parts. They also claimed that the child was physically assaulted and threatened not to tell anyone about the incident.
After returning home, the child reportedly informed his parents about what had happened. The family said they tried to contact the teacher but received no response. They also alleged that when they approached the school principal and management, they were threatened instead of being offered assistance.
The child's father later filed a complaint with the police. Based on the complaint, an FIR has been registered, and the child has been sent for medical examination as part of the investigation.
Senior police officer Atul Singh confirmed that a case has been registered and said the matter is being investigated. He added that appropriate legal action will be taken based on the findings of the investigation.
Police have not yet released the results of the investigation, and the allegations remain under inquiry. The school administration has not publicly responded to the allegations at the time of writing.
